Con has extensive experience in funds management and related transactions, acting in M&A superannuation transactions involving managed funds and financial service providers.

Con Tzerefos has comprehensive experience in financial services and commercial transactions. Con acts for local and offshore fund managers, trustees and other industry participants on all aspects of financial services regulation including licensing, regulation of foreign providers in Australia, establishment of funds, fund raising, investment management agreements, regulatory and compliance matters involving ASIC, and APRA regulation.

Con advises on the structuring of all forms of managed funds, including property and infrastructure funds, separately managed accounts, platforms and private equity funds, and drafting documentation for the establishment and management of registered and unregistered managed investment schemes. Con also advises on disclosure requirements for retail and wholesale offerings in due diligence investigations and assists with asset acquisitions, management and sales.

  • Gresham House | Lead Partner | 2026 | In establishing a fund platform with Aviva Investors, CEFC and a Gresham House managed fund to establish and manage timberland and afforestation (including associated carbon credits) assets in Tasmania, Australia.
  • CC Capital Partners, LLC | Partner | 2026 | On its acquisition of Insignia Financial Ltd by way of a scheme of arrangement valued at approximately $3.3 billion.
  • Guild Group Holdings Limited | Lead Partner | 2023 | In relation to the sale of its superannuation business to Future Super.
  • Hannover Life Re of Australasia Ltd | Lead Partner | 2024 | On its acquisition of the Australian direct life insurance portfolio of Swiss Re pursuant to a scheme under Part 9 of the Life Insurance Act.
  • Nippon Life Insurance Company | Partner | 2024 | On its acquisition of the remaining interest of 20% in MLC Life from NAB for A$500 million; and its acquisition of Resolution Life for US$8.2 billion.
  • AIA Australia Limited | Lead Partner | 2024 | On the acquisition of the retail life insurance business from Integrity Life Australia Limited pursuant to a scheme under Part 9 of the Life Insurance Act.
  • Resolution Life Group | Lead Partner | 2020 and 2022 | On the acquisition of and 80% interest in AMP Life and on the subsequent acquisition of the remaining 20% minority interest from AMP.
